Who is new Ferrari CEO Benedetto Vigna?
Italian luxury sports car maker and Formula 1 team, Ferrari named as its (relatively unknown) new chief executive Benedetto Vigna, a physics graduate who has spent the last 26 years at chipmaker STMicroelectronics. Apart from leading the most iconic car manufacturer and one of the most recognisable global brands, he will have to revive Ferrari's fortunes in Formula 1 after its worst racing season in 40 years in 2020. Following are some highlights of Vigna's career. Vigna, 52, leads ST's division in charge of sensors and micro-electromechanical systems (MEMS), the company's biggest and most profitable business in 2020.
